The EFM32HG210F32G-B-QFN32R is a microcontroller belonging to the EFM32HG210 series, designed and manufactured by Silicon Labs. The EFM32HG210F32G-B-QFN32R features a compact QFN32 package with a detailed pinout for connecting to external components and peripherals. The pin configuration includes power supply pins, GPIO pins, communication interface pins, and analog input/output pins.
The EFM32HG210F32G-B-QFN32R operates based on the ARM Cortex-M0+ core architecture, utilizing low-power modes and integrated peripherals to efficiently execute embedded tasks. It follows standard microcontroller operation principles, including instruction execution, peripheral interfacing, and power management.
The microcontroller is well-suited for various embedded applications, including: - Battery-powered IoT devices - Sensor nodes for industrial monitoring systems - Portable healthcare and fitness devices - Home automation and smart energy management systems
